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Browsing lakewood ranch, United Kingdom business
Ranch House Chapel Lane Nottingham, NG13 8GF
34 Radway Rd | Southampton, SO15 7PJ
1 Orchard Bungalows, Bodenham, Hereford | Hereford, HR1 3JS
Unit 101 Northside Studios 16 29 | London, E8 4QF
1 Chapel Lane | Nottingham, NG13 8GF
Station Road, Honeybourne | Worcestershire, WR11 7P
Devonshire House | Leicestershire | Loughborough, le11 3df
44# Victoria Street | Lancashire | Littleborough, ol15 9db
Culzean Rd, Maybole | Kilmarnock, KA19 8DU
Devonshire House | loughborough
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!